Actively interviewing - APPLY NOWIP Docketing SpecialistHybrid | Pittsburgh, PAA respected law firm is seeking an experienced IP Docketing Specialist to support its Intellectual Property Practice Group. This role is critical to managing patent and trademark deadlines, maintaining accurate docketing records, and supporting attorneys handling domestic and international IP portfolios.This is a hybrid position based in Pittsburgh, PA, offering stability, collaboration, and exposure to sophisticated IP work.Key Responsibilities: Manage and calendar critical deadlines for patent and trademark filings, formalities, Office Actions, and maintenance feesReceive, review, and organize electronic correspondence from USPTO, WIPO, foreign patent offices, and foreign agents into the docketing systemDistribute incoming correspondence efficiently to the appropriate attorney teamsGenerate both standard and custom docketing reports for attorneys and leadershipContinuously monitor deadlines to ensure timely compliance and accuracyEvaluate outstanding docket items, coordinate with supervisors, and update or adjust matters as requiredOpen, maintain, and close matters within the docketing databaseSupport client intakes, case transfers, and changes in counsel due to new clients or attorney transitionsCollaborate in IP practice group and docketing team meetingsPerform other administrative and docketing tasks to support the IP team Preferred Qualifications: High school diploma required; additional education is a plusMinimum of 3 years of IP docketing or related experience in a law firm or corporate environmentSolid understanding of U.S. and foreign patent and trademark prosecution processes, including:Provisional and Nonprovisional Applications, PCT Applications & Madrid Protocol FilingsExperience with USPTO, WIPO, and other foreign patent/trademark officesFamiliarity with docketing terminology, best practices, and relevant IP lawsAbility to independently determine priority dates, calculate deadlines, and verify docketing entriesProficiency with IP docketing software (Patricia preferred; Anaqua a plus)Comfortable navigating IP office systems such as EFS-Web, Public/Private PAIR, TEAS, and TSDRStrong computer skills with the ability to manage, analyze, and interpret dataExcellent attention to detail, organizational skills, and time managementSelf-motivated, collaborative, and capable of working effectively in a fast-paced, deadline-driven environment Salary commensurate with candidate experience and other job-related factors permitted by law.How to Apply: Email your resume to: jackie.tuckergogpac /Text: (605) 305-3814#LegalCareers #ConfidentialSearch #LegalJobs #CareerMove #LegalRecruiter #LetsTalk #LegalJobsb #HiringLegal #LawJobs #LegalCareers #LegalTalen #AttorneyJobs #LawFirmHiring #ParalegalJobs #LegalAssistantJobs #LegalSupportJobs #NowHiringAttorneys #LitigationJobs #CorporateLawJobs #TrialLawyerJobs #pittsburghpaAll qualified applicants will receive consideration without regard to race, age, color, sex (including pregnancy), religion, national origin, disability, sexual orientation, gender identity, marital status, military status, genetic information, or any other status protected by applicable laws or regulations.
